Olympus Camedia D-40 Zoom Digital Camera

More Information Notes & Features Compatible with 3.3V SmartMedia cards in capacities of 4, 8, 16, 32, 64 and 128 MB. Has built-in speaker. Complies with USB Mass Storage Class (dubbed USB AutoConnect by Olympus) for driverless use with Windows 2000, Me and XP, or MacOS 8.6+. Lens has 7 elements in 5 groups. Macro focusing distance of 10cm is at wide-angle - tele macro distance is 25cm. Flash recharges in 6 seconds. 10-position mode dial brings camera options into the interface rather than hiding them in menus; 'My Image' mode allows quick access to stored user settings. LCD brightness can be adjusted. As well as resolutions listed above, also has resolutions of 2272 x 1704 and 640 x 480 pixels, and interpolated resolutions of 3200 x 2400, 2816 x 2112 and 2560 x 1920 pixels. In-camera interpolation (referred to as Optimum Image Enlargement mode by Olympus) uses bicubic algorithm before JPEG compression is applied. Noise reduction system automatically captures dark-current frame after exposures greater than 1 second, and uses this to remove noise from actual image. Color management varies with camera mode - warm tones are enhanced in portrait modes, cool tones are enhanced in landscape modes. Has automatic pixel mapping feature to automatically map out stuck/dead pixels via a menu option. Manual focus mode has distance gauge. Has auto-exposure bracketing function (1/2 and 1EV steps, 3 or 5 images).Has white balance compensation function. Shutter speeds above 1/2 second available in slow synchro (up to 4 seconds) or manual (up to 16 seconds) modes only. Shutter speeds in movie mode 1/30 to 1/10000 second. Video mode not switchable - US model has NTSC video, European model has PAL. Movie mode frame-rate is 15fps on NTSC model, 12.5fps on PAL model. Movie length (max/min res) for NTSC model is 34/137 seconds, for PAL model is 41/161 seconds. Can rotate images, crop/index video files in-camera. Comes bundled with Strap, 16MB SmartMedia, USB cable, Audio and Video cable, Lithium battery LB-01 and Remote controller RM-1. Bundled 16MB SmartMedia card enables in-camera panorama function.
